Equipment preparation and compatibility testing
Before you start setting up, make sure that your air conditioner model Kentatsu Supports Smart Wi-Fi. This option is usually indicated by a corresponding logo on the front panel of the indoor unit or mentioned in the model's technical specifications. If the module is not built-in, it must be purchased separately and installed inside the enclosure, which is best left to a qualified technician.
The operating frequency of your home router is critical. Most modules Smart Wi-Fi HVAC equipment operates exclusively in the 2.4 GHz band. If your router only broadcasts at 5 GHz or combines both bands under one name, connection issues may occur.
You'll also need an iOS or Android smartphone with the appropriate app installed. Make sure your device has GPS enabled, as modern operating systems require location permission to scan for available Wi-Fi networks.

For controlling climate control equipment Kentatsu specialized software is used. Currently, the main application is Kentatsu Smart, which is available in the official Google Play and App Stores. Older models or specific series may use universal platforms, such as Smart Life or Tuya Smart, but the current instructions are focused on the proprietary solution.
Download the app using the QR code in the user manual or by searching for it in the app store. After installation, launch the app and create an account. Registration is required to save settings and access the device remotely via the cloud server.
When registering, please provide a valid email address and create a strong password. This will ensure the security of your account and protect your climate control system from unauthorized access.

Pairing the device with the router requires careful attention, but follows a standard procedure. First, turn on the air conditioner and ensure the Wi-Fi indicator on the indoor unit's display is off or blinking, indicating it's ready for setup.
Launch the application Kentatsu Smart On your smartphone, log in. Tap the Add Device button (usually the plus symbol in the corner of the screen). The app will prompt you to select the device type—select "Air Conditioner" or "Split AC" from the list of available categories.
Next, follow the instructions on the screen:
- 📱 Select your home Wi-Fi network from the list and enter the router password.
- ⚡ Put the air conditioner into pairing mode: on the remote control, simultaneously press the “Mode” and “Fan” buttons (or the special “Wi-Fi” button, if available) and hold them for 3-5 seconds until the Wi-Fi icon appears on the screen of the remote control or the indoor unit.
- 🔗 Tap "Confirm" in the app and wait for the device to be automatically detected.
- ✅ After a successful connection, assign a name to the device (for example, "Living Room" or "Office") for easy management.

Scripting and Remote Control
Once successfully connected, you'll have extensive control options. You can not only turn the device on and off, but also configure complex scenarios. For example, you can set a timer to turn it on an hour before you arrive home or configure it to turn off automatically when a window is opened (if equipped with a sensor).
The app interface allows you to adjust the temperature, fan speed, damper direction, and operating mode (cooling, heating, dehumidification, ventilation). All changes made via smartphone are instantly displayed on the indoor unit's display.
The energy consumption statistics feature deserves special attention. The app can track how much electricity your Kentatsu air conditioner per day or month, which helps optimize utility costs.
What should I do if the app doesn't detect the air conditioner?
Make sure your phone is connected to a 2.4 GHz network. Try disabling mobile data (3G/4G) during setup, leaving only Wi-Fi. Also, check that your router's firewall isn't blocking new devices.

Modern systems allow you to integrate your air conditioner into larger smart home ecosystems. Check if your model supports voice assistants such as Alice, Siri, or Google Assistant. This will allow you to control your climate control using voice commands.
Geo-tracking is also available. The app tracks your smartphone's location and can automatically turn off the air conditioner when you leave home and turn it on when you return. This ensures maximum energy efficiency.
Please remember that for remote control to function properly, the air conditioner itself must have constant access to power. If you lose power to the room (for example, if you go on vacation and turn off the circuit breakers), the Wi-Fi module will also be disabled, and remote control will be impossible until power is restored.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Is it possible to control an air conditioner if there is no internet but there is a Wi-Fi router?
No, remote control via the app requires internet access. Local control is only possible with the remote control. However, some models support local control via LAN if the phone and air conditioner are on the same network, but this requires complex setup and is not guaranteed by all firmware versions.
How many devices can be connected to one account?
There is usually no limit on the number of devices per account. You can add multiple air conditioners. Kentatsu and control them all together or separately, grouping them by rooms.
What should I do if my Wi-Fi password has changed?
You'll need to reconfigure the air conditioner's network connection. Remove the device in the app, then re-pair it using the new router password.
Does the control work if the phone switches to mobile Internet (4G/5G)?
Yes, this is the main advantage of Smart functions. As long as the air conditioner is connected to your home Wi-Fi, you can control it via your mobile internet connection from anywhere in the world with cellular coverage.
How to reset the Wi-Fi module settings?
To reset, you typically need to press and hold the Wi-Fi button on the remote control or indoor unit for 10 seconds until you hear a beep or the indicator light changes. Refer to your model's instructions for the exact combination.
